Egg-stra special
Add a special touch to your eggs this Easter. Before dipping each egg in Easter egg dye, adhere a sticker with an Easter greeting – here German for “Happy Easter” – to the egg as desired (sticker and dye both from Brauns-Heitmann). When the egg has been dyed to the color of your liking, remove it from the dye and let it dry. Now peel off the sticker again – leaving a white Easter wish on your colored egg!
Egg-squisite
As easy as it gets. The retro-look egg cups from the former GDR can be ordered from “ok-Versand” (approx. 13 Euros for 6 egg cups). All you have to do is add your own Easter egg – dyed as described above, but this time using a bunny sticker.
Make your point
Self-adhesive paper dots (office supplies) turn simple dyed eggs into small works of art!
Top it off!
The cheerful crocheted hats do double duty – they keep your breakfast eggs warm and give your table a festive touch.
By the way.....these would be a great project for beginning crocheters – see our crochet course.
Put your eggs in one basket
A soft nest for your Easter eggs. The felted basket of pink wool will protect raw eggs and keep boiled eggs warm.
A bevy of bunnies
Make several of these bunnies to hang on an Easter bouquet or appliqué bunny shapes on your Easter tablecloth. With our patterns, these pastel-colored bunnies will quickly hop into your home....
Family Longears
These distinctive bunnies have been folded from fabric napkins. They are happy to wait patiently on your Easter table until they are needed.
Buckets for baskets
This year the bunny brings sweet treats by the bucketful!
